Amendment 22" by Joseph Heller is a classic of American literature, a satirical work that follows soldiers during World War II. The main character, Lieutenant Yossarian, is trying to survive in the face of military bureaucracy and absurdity. "Amendment 22" is the rule that a soldier, if he wants to avoid dangerous assignments, must admit to being insane. But if he realizes this and submits a statement about his madness in order to avoid combat missions, he, therefore, is already reasonable and, therefore, cannot avoid following orders. Heller explores with irony and sharp humor themes of the absurdity of war, bureaucracy and human stupidity.
